Edgemoor's Climate Is Rough on Windows — Here's Why
Edgemoor sits close enough to Bellingham Bay that salt-laden air is a real factor in how building materials age, not just a talking point. Combine that with Whatcom County's long wet season, frequent driving rain off the water, and months of shade and moss growth under mature tree canopy, and you get a set of conditions that wears out ordinary windows faster than homeowners expect. Metal hardware corrodes. Wood trim holds moisture longer than it should. Seals that would last two decades in a dry climate start failing in twelve or fifteen years here.
None of this is unique to any one street in Edgemoor — it's the nature of living this close to Bellingham Bay in Northwest Washington. But it does mean that windows chosen and installed without that context in mind tend to underperform early: fogged glass, soft trim, stuck sashes, and heating bills that creep up every winter.

What "Energy-Efficient" Actually Means Here
Energy-efficient windows aren't just about the marketing sticker — they're rated on numbers that matter differently depending on climate. In a marine climate like Bellingham's, where winters are mild but long and cloudy, and summer cooling loads are modest, two ratings matter most:
- U-factor — how well the window resists heat loss. Lower is better. This is the number that matters most for our heating-dominated climate.
- SHGC (Solar Heat Gain Coefficient) — how much solar heat passes through the glass. In our climate, a moderate SHGC is usually the right call — enough to pick up some free winter warmth without overheating rooms with a lot of western or water-facing glass.
A window that's marketed as "energy-efficient" in a hot, dry climate isn't necessarily the right spec for a home near Bellingham Bay. We look at U-factor and SHGC together, along with the home's orientation, before recommending a glass package.
Glass Package Basics
Most Edgemoor homeowners are choosing between double-pane low-E glass with argon fill and triple-pane options. Double-pane low-E with argon is the standard energy-efficient choice for this region and, in most cases, delivers the best balance of performance and cost. Triple-pane adds incremental efficiency and sound dampening — worth considering on a home closer to the water or a busier street, but it's a real cost jump and the payback in this climate is longer than people assume. Frame Material: What Holds Up Near the Bay
Frame material matters as much as the glass in a salt-air, high-rainfall environment. Here's how the common options compare for this specific setting:
| Frame Material | Moisture / Salt-Air Resistance | Maintenance | Best Fit |
|---|---|---|---|
| Vinyl | Good — won't corrode or rot; seams are the main long-term watch point | Low | Most Edgemoor homes; best value for efficiency per dollar |
| Fiberglass | Very good — dimensionally stable in temperature swings, resists moisture well | Low | Homes with more direct water/wind exposure or larger window openings |
| Wood-clad | Depends heavily on cladding integrity and installation quality; interior wood can be affected by trapped moisture if flashing fails | Higher | Homes prioritizing a specific interior wood look, with a clear maintenance plan |
| Bare aluminum | Poor in salt air — prone to corrosion and is a weak thermal performer | Moderate | Generally not our recommendation for this location |
We're not going to tell you a product is "bad" — every material has a legitimate use case. Our professional standard for Edgemoor specifically leans toward vinyl and fiberglass because they hold up with the least maintenance burden in sustained salt air and rain, and because moisture-related failures are the most common problem we're called out to fix in this area.
Signs Your Current Windows Are Underperforming
Homeowners often live with a slow decline in window performance for years before addressing it, mostly because the signs show up gradually. Worth a look if any of these sound familiar:
- Visible fog, condensation, or a milky haze between the panes (seal failure — not fixable, only replaceable)
- Windows that are difficult to open or close, especially in wet months (swelling from moisture intrusion)
- Moss, algae, or dark staining building up on sills or bottom trim
- Cold drafts near the window frame during winter storms even with the window fully latched
- Noticeably higher heating bills compared to similar-sized homes nearby
- Soft or spongy trim/sill wood when pressed
- Rattling or whistling during high wind off the water
Why Installation Quality Matters More Than the Window Itself
This is the part that gets skipped in most window conversations, and it's the part that actually determines whether a window lasts 10 years or 30 in this climate. A high-end window installed with poor flashing will fail faster than a mid-range window installed correctly. What a Correct Install Involves
- Full removal of the old window and inspection of the surrounding sheathing and framing for hidden rot or moisture damage before anything new goes in
- Proper pan flashing at the sill to direct any water that gets past the window back out, not into the wall cavity
- Correct integration of window flashing tape with the home's existing weather-resistant barrier — sequenced so water always sheds downward and outward, never trapped behind the siding
- Low-expansion foam or backer rod insulation around the frame — enough to seal the gap without bowing the frame out of square
- Sloped, properly caulked exterior sills and trim that shed water instead of holding it, which also cuts down on moss and algae buildup
- Interior trim and finish work that leaves no gaps for air leakage
Skipping or rushing any one of these steps is how homeowners end up with hidden rot behind a brand-new window five years later. It's a much more expensive fix than the window itself.
